1Make the sweet potato fries: Wash and dry all produce. Preheat the oven to 425 degrees. Cut the sweet potatoes into thin sticks, (like French fries). Toss them on a baking sheet with a large drizzle of olive oil and a pinch of salt and pepper . Place in the oven for ⏱️ 25 minutes , tossing once, until golden brown.sweet potatoes: 2 unit, olive oil: 2 tbsp, salt, pepper -
2Prep the remaining ingredients: Mince the garlic . Peel and grate the carrots with a box grater . Halve, peel, and finely dice the red onion . Place ½ cup diced onion aside in a large bowl .garlic: 4 clove, carrots: 2 unit, red onion: 2 unit -
3Make the barbecue sauce: Heat a large drizzle of oil in a small pot over medium heat before adding the remaining onion. Cook, tossing, for ⏱️ 3 minutes , until softened. Add the chili powder (start with 1 teaspoon and go up from there) and cook another ⏱️ 1 minutes , until fragrant. Add the BBQ sauce , 2 teaspoons white wine vinegar , and water to the pot. Reduce to a low simmer until ready to use.chili powder: 2 tsp, BBQ sauce: 4 oz, white wine vinegar: 4 tbsp, water: ½ cup
-
4Cook the burgers: Add the ground pork and garlic to the bowl with the diced onion. Season generously with salt and pepper (we used 1 teaspoon kosher salt). Form into 4 patties. Heat a large drizzle of oil in a large pan over medium-high heat. Add the patties to the pan. Cook ⏱️ 6 minutes per side, until cooked through.ground pork: 20 oz -
5Make the coleslaw: While the burgers cook, combine the remaining vinegar, 3 Tablespoons mayonnaise , and sugar in a large bowl . Toss in the shredded red cabbage and carrots. Season with salt and pepper.mayonnaise: 2 jar, sugar: 2 tsp, shredded red cabbage: 8 oz -
6Finish and plate: Split the potato buns and place in the oven to toast ⏱️ 3 minutes . Spread each bun with barbecue sauce, top with a pork burger, and finish with some of the coleslaw. Serve the sweet potato fries and remaining coleslaw on the side. Use any extra barbecue sauce and mayonnaise for dipping the fries. Enjoy!potato buns: 4 unit
